He watched you from his spot in the kitchen; leaning against the counter, a beer bottle hanging loosely from his fingers. You were talking with your friends in a group, beaming, laughing, eyes lit with joy. He watched how your boyfriend sauntered over, handing you the bottle of the (wrong) beer you had asked for. The sight of it made you pause, then quickly recover as you smiled at your boyfriend and thanked him, taking the drink. But he saw it. The faintest wrinkling of your nose, the falter in your smile, the dimming of your elation.
He saw you try to enjoy the drink your boyfriend got you. Every grimace, every purse of your lips. It wasn’t even five minutes before he saw you turn to your friends, giving whatever excuse you could think of. To find a chaser, get some water. He was already rummaging through the fridge when you entered the kitchen.
“Excuse me,” he heard you politely call out when he finally found your typical poison of choice. He stood. “Do you think you could grab me-” He turned, opening the bottle silently and handing it over- “a bottle… of…”
He smirked, grabbing his own bottle where he left it on the counter and taking a sip. “Hey. Saw you coming, figured you wanted something else.”
You didn’t acknowledge the dig against your partner. Instead, you raised your bottle and took a long drink. “Didn’t see you when we came in,” you say instead, shuffling over to stand beside him against the counter. “Haven’t seen you in a minute.”
He shrugged, hearing the warning in your tone for what it was. “Been busy. Work.”
“Ah.”
He watched you out of the corner of his eye. You tapped at the neck of your bottle rhythmically, letting the condensation drop onto your fingers. Your rings gleamed against the glass, the jewels in your ears twinkling. He arched a brow at the new silver piece resting on your décolletage, not the one you typically wore.
“New necklace?” He prompted, tone casual but subtle distaste written all over his face.
Your free hand immediately went to it, fiddling with the chain. “Ah! Yeah,” you acknowledged, voice higher, tight. “He got it for me. Anniversary gift.”
Now both his brows were raised. Raising his drink to his lips, he downed the rest before setting the bottle down on the counter. He turned to face you, you matched him. You looked up at him in confusion, your strained smile still on your lips. Bringing a hand up, he watched your expression carefully. How you stilled when his fingers just barely brushed the side of your face. The blush on your cheeks when he gently nudged at the small gold hoop in your lobe, your breath hitching when he leaned in close.
“When you no longer want to settle for less-” he murmured, breath hot on your skin; you shivered, he smirked- “let me know.”

LIA'S RIPTIDE OC MASTERPOST :D
For those who are interested, here's some lore about my OCs! I kept everything as short and concise as possible (mostly) but it's still super long, so prepare yourself accordingly should you choose to continue on.
Esther 'Ink' Copperplate (Shadar-Kai, Paladin/Sorcerer, she/her), Captain of the Atlas Pirates.
She and her family escaped the Shadowfell and came to Mana when she was around 7. Her parents really wanted her and her brother Jasper to join the Navy so they could be 'successful'. Jasper was all for this plan, but it never really interested Esther. This created a rift in the family, Jasper being the favorite child, Esther being ignored and left to fend for herself most of the time.
Her safe place on her home island was the local tavern. She'd go there to listen to adventurers stories and daydream about getting off this island.
When she was about 12, a new pirate crew (the Merrythorne Pirates) stopped by. Their navigator, a blue tiefling named Terrance, caught Esther's attention immediately. He was working on one of his maps and it was beautiful. Terrance was happy to tell Esther about cartography, and even gave her the nickname 'Ink" because the vitiligo spots on her skin looked like the ink splotches on his own hands. He even colored in her spots with the colorful inks he used to help show her what a unique and beautiful thing they were.
Ink got very close to this pirate crew. She thought of them as family, more so than her actual blood relatives. She'd tell them about her successes, her struggles, even became Terrence's unofficial protege because she loved mapmaking so much. She often asked if she could just join their crew and get off this horrible island, but Captain Merrythorne insisted she had to finish school first. Once she was 18, she'd be allowed to join.
When Ink was 15, Jasper joined the Navy. He was always a conniving little snake, so he made his way up the ladder quickly. He'd write home about all his glorious achievements and any time he visited, he'd make sure to point out that Ink had done nothing her parents could be proud of. She couldn't wait to join Merrythorne's crew.
Almost a year before her 18th birthday, she wandered down to the tavern, hoping to see Merrythorne and his crew again. When she got there, she saw no pirates, but her brother who was wearing Terrance's pirate coat. The coat was terribly damaged, sleeves ripped off, tears in the tails, and a bloody stained bullet hole through Terrance's signature compass rose that had been embroidered on the back.
Ink immediately knew what had happened. Jasper had killed her mentor and friend. She avoided her brother like the plague, her only interaction with him before his visit ended was him giving her Terrance's coat, "So you always remember what happens to pirates in the end." (yeah Jasper's the worst-)
The next time Merrythorne and his crew came around, they let her join early. She fit in perfectly, taking Terrance's place as navigator. It took Ink a while (cause traumaaaa) but slowly, she started to notice she was happier on this ship than she'd ever been on her home island. Life felt exciting and she always looked forward to what might happen next.
Terrance's death took a toll on her though. She became obsessive about keeping her crew safe, tracking every single navy, pirate, and bounty hunter ship she found out about meticulously. She kept all this information in a ledger, and having this information actually saved them more than a few times. She ended up getting so good at this tracking ordeal that other crews asked her to go over their charted courses to make sure they wouldn't run into any trouble.
She did other little things to try to put her mind at ease as well. Terrance had shared with her his little superstition that putting a braid in someone's hair was a good luck charm. She always kept her hair braided, and did the same for any crewmate that would let her. (Basically she has ocd, and things like the braids and picking at the spots on her hands or tapping all 4 corners of a map before beginning work are her compulsions.)
Ink was living her pirate dreams, having the time of her life . . . until her 20th birthday.
Merrythorne's crew LOVED celebrating birthdays. The crew cared so deeply about each other, so getting to celebrate someone's mere existence was always a delightful event. This particular birthday, Ink received a magic ledger that never ran out of pages from her crew, and she was ecstatic. So excited, in fact that when Merrythorne said they were going to spend the day partying in Allport, Ink forgot to check if it was safe to do so.
Everything was perfect until around sunset, when Navy busted down the doors of the tavern they were in and took Ink hostage. Two crewmembers died in the scuffle, the rest escaping back to the ship.
Ink woke up in a Navy prison. Jasper was the one who had orchestrated her capture, because she'd been a massive thorn in the Navy's side for ages, and he wanted the glory. Ink had accrued a massive bounty by this point from stealing Navy information so she could warn pirates of ambushes.
There's a lot of dramatic dialogue here in her full backstory that I might post the link to when I go through and make sure it's ready, but basically Jasper tortures Ink to try and gain the location of the rest of her crew. He does this by cutting into her spots with a knife and painting them with her own blood. Jasper would often ask Ink about her visits with the pirates just so he could ridicule her, so he knew about Terrance and his efforts to show Ink she was enough. So of course, the best way to tear her down was to sour those memories.
This whole time, Ink stays silent, praying that her crew will leave her behind, because she can't take it if they go down because of her. Much to her dismay, she hears her name being called by familiar voices who are fighting their way through the prison to get to her.
The escape is a bloodbath, Navy soldiers and Ink's friends falling dead left and right. Only Ink, Merrythorne, and 2 other crewmembers make it to the lobby.
I should now mention, Ink has never been able to use ranged weapons. She's terrible at it. Can't accurately fire a gun for the life of her, so she uses a longsword instead.
Before the few survivors of the Merrythorne pirates can escape, Jasper manages to grapple the captain, holding a knife to his neck. He hesitates, having never killed someone before. His senior officer is screaming at him to finish the job, but he just can't in that moment.
In the fray, a pistol skitters to Ink's feet as she turns to see Merrythorne get captured. Having no other options, she picks it up and fires at Jasper in a desperate attempt to keep Merrythorne alive. She aims for her brother's head, and while she doesn't miss, she also doesn't hit her target. The bullet goes through Jasper's chest, and as he goes down, he slices the captains neck open. Merrythorne is dead.
Ink and her two remaining crewmates manage to escape, though her friends decide to retire not long after. Ink keeps the ship, (which I have yet to name, so if anyone has ideas, please tell me!) but has no crew. She also keeps the pistol, in hopes that one day she will be given another opportunity to confront Jasper and hit her intended target.
